The short version

Census Tract 40.05 has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$30,961. Population has held roughly steady since 2020. 8%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 36%. Median home value has risen by half since 2020, reaching $354,800. At a median age of 29.0, residents skew younger than the country as a whole. Households here earn about 58% less than the Fresno County median.
